As the review in French states, the quality is not high and it didn’t really work out of the box, but the price is low and with some mods it’s functional. Thus, 3 stars.The problems are mostly visible in the listing pics, which are accurate:- The clamping gap is too small, optimized for about half the thickness of a typical bass drum hoop which is at least 3/8”. I had to do some bending on the clamp piece and enlarge the clamping bolt hole.- The clamping piece that bears on the inside of the hoop has no curvature to properly fit inside the round hoop. Again, I bent the clamping piece to put slight angles on the ends, pic attached.- The L-rod doesn’t quite fit in the holes. I mean, it does, it comes assembled, but it’s very tight and difficult to get out. The other review mentioned this. I drilled the holes out just slightly.- The L-rod is aluminum, which I found surprising, but it seems adequate for my small cowbell. Assembled pic attached. This is going on my at-home practice kit, as I have a bigger cowbell with a different mount for my gigging kit. This cowbell is tiny and kinda cheesy but will be fine to practice with, and this mount is fine. It would probably be fine for a bigger ‘bell also, but I didn’t try it.So all in all, the price is right but it required a lot of fiddling. I’m a garage guy and kinda like fiddling, so that was OK. Once modified, it seems plenty sturdy and gives nice adjustability.
